Good if you can afford the work it'll need!

GoodbyeTerrain, 04/12/2023
2012 GMC Terrain SLE-2 4dr SUV AWD (2.4L 4cyl 6A)
2 of 2 people found this review helpful

Pros: I think it's a pretty attractive car and has plenty of space inside. When it's running well, it's a good car. It let me drive it for a long time with the check engine light on.... until it didn't anymore (the light was due to an old error - I wasn't totally neglecting it). Cons: Had to have the rear main seal replaced; timing chain issues or whatever it's called; lots of recalls; previous owner had a new engine put in (unbeknownst to me when I bought it); windows don't roll up very well when you're accelerating (have to slow down and give it a helping hand to get up); replaced battery twice in the 4 years I've owned it; not sure what the issue is now, but after putting about $2500 in repairs into it, I'm ready to trade it. It's dying when it comes to a complete stop now, and I just don't have the time to get it fixed anymore. Shame, too, because it's such a good looking vehicle.

DO NOT BUY FOR FUEL ECONOMY

lakegirl2003, 12/30/2012
2012 GMC Terrain SLT-1 4dr SUV (2.4L 4cyl 6A)
3 of 4 people found this review helpful

I originally bought a V6 Terrain which got around 25mpg. It was totaled so then I bought a V4 thinking I would get at least 27mpg which I would be satisfied with since it is a SUV. I get between 22-24mpg with the V4. I take 70miles of interstate and drive 75mph to work. Extremely disappointed the first day of work with my new Terrain then I thought well maybe it needs broken in. It also is a loud idle engine like a almost ticking sound. The dealership checked it out and said it sounds like a V4. I have problems with the transmission sticking at 3rpms for a long time then it decides to shift up. My back up camera has blanked out about 4 times. Besides that it is very nice vehicle.
